Fall is here even though the weather doesn’t reflect that at the moment. It’s a bit hot in Georgia at this time, but I did pull out a few of my fall decor items to get the house in the mood for autumn. I don’t go all out with tons of pumpkins and all of that, but I do enjoy a few things around the house that reflect the season.

The living room always gets something on the coffee table, so it’s just a small nod to fall.

I’ve been using my limelight hydrangeas more and more at the end of the summer season, because they dry so well and I love their color at this time of year. A small white faux pumpkin and preserved leaves and a cute blue owl is all that I used with the limelights in a rattan wrapped glass vase.

The console table always gets decorated for the season and so this year I added a fall inspired canvas print that I had that reflects the colors of autumn as well as blues that I love.

I’ve had all of these things for years and I do enjoy getting them out again every year. A pottery vase and pretty bowl with a leaf picks up the colors in the print. I love that little oil painting that I got in Round Top one year. Those faux fall leaves are bright, but I love them.

It’s amazing how cute white faux pumpkins can look under glass on top of a cake plate. That’s a small wreath underneath.
